I am running the stock springs, with 7.5 wt oil at 80mm from the top with the springs out and fork and cartriges fully compressed. This gives a nice feel over the small stuff with plenty of bottoming resistance. BTW, i weigh 170 lbs without gear.

I have an 04' demo 9 and my evil srs bolted right up using the iscg adapter that comes with the guide. All you need to do is install it backwards so the machined out side faces the chainrings. It works perfect and i have a great chainline.
